What Are New Year Greeting Cards?

New year greeting cards are visual messages sent to celebrate the transition into a new year - whether it's December 31st (Western New Year), Chinese Spring Festival, or Japanese Shōgatsu. They combine festive imagery (fireworks, clocks, champagne) with warm wishes or cultural blessings.

Traditional vs Digital New Year Cards

Traditional cards ruled for centuries: fold-out cardstock, hand-written notes, mailed weeks in advance. Think Hallmark stores and FedEx printing services charging $2-5 per card.

Digital cards flipped the script in the 2000s. Email greetings, social media posts, and digital invitations made sending free - but often felt impersonal.

Now? The hybrid approach wins: AI-generated designs you can print professionally or share digitally. You get the personalization of custom design without the time or cost.

Step 1: Choose Your Design Style

Before opening any tool, decide on your visual direction. Four main styles dominate 2026:

Classic Elegant: Gold accents, champagne glasses, fireworks at midnight, cursive typography. Best for formal business cards or sophisticated personal greetings.

Modern Minimalist: Geometric shapes, gradients (rose gold to navy), clean sans-serif fonts. Perfect for tech companies or contemporary aesthetics.

Cute & Playful: Cartoon animals (especially 2026's zodiac animal), emoji-style icons, bright colors. Great for social media posts or family cards.

Cultural Themes:

  • Chinese New Year: Red envelopes, lanterns, dragons, gold coins
  • Japanese New Year: Mount Fuji, sunrise (hatsuhinode), bamboo, traditional calligraphy
  • Western New Year: Clocks striking midnight, confetti, party hats

Pick one. Mixing styles creates visual confusion.

Step 5: Export and Share

For Digital Use (social media, email):

  • Format: PNG or JPG
  • Resolution: 1080×1080 (Instagram), 1200×630 (Facebook)
  • Download directly from SeaArt

For Printing:

  • Format: PNG (no compression) or PDF
  • Resolution: 300 DPI minimum (set in SeaArt settings)
  • Size: Standard greeting card is 5×7 inches (1500×2100 pixels at 300 DPI)
  • Print services: Vistaprint, Printful, or local print shops

What's the best resolution for printing greeting cards?

Use 300 DPI at the final print size; for a standard 5×7 inch card, that’s 1500×2100 pixels. Set the size before generating and export as PNG for print.
